    RCBS warrantied 2 items for me in early August and

    rcbs.tech@ATK.COM

    was the e-mail they used to answer me back then. I filled out the online request form that you show above and they answered me very quickly, less than 4 hours.

    One item was the cap for my kinetic bullet puller and they asked zero questions just immedately put a new cap AND a new chuck in the mail.

    The second item was a large rifle primer pocket uniformer that had the center of the cutting flutes shear off and that happened 10 years ago. I had to have the tool the day it broke and I went out locally and bought another and just did not mention the time lag. They asked that I send the broken tool in and they sent me a new one.

Abbreviations used in Reloading

BP Bronze Point IMR Improved Military Rifle PTD Pointed
BR Bench Rest M Magnum RN Round Nose
BT Boat Tail PL Power-Lokt SP Soft Point
C Compressed Charge PR Primer SPCL Soft Point "Core-Lokt"
HP Hollow Point PSPCL Pointed Soft Point "Core Lokt" C.O.L. Cartridge Overall Length
PSP Pointed Soft Point Spz Spitzer Point SBT Spitzer Boat Tail
LRN Lead Round Nose LWC Lead Wad Cutter LSWC Lead Semi Wad Cutter
GC Gas Check
